Output 31c6d71bd9b96c538c4eab7316522c1ebb46c271def7dc2235fd6262605f2026:0

value
1294666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ed8ff35783d1ed5963874e7efe71c007da20bf75 OP_EQUAL
address
3PM8WsGDNWn5Bps761aGTgJJRQ2NThNHJE
transaction
31c6d71bd9b96c538c4eab7316522c1ebb46c271def7dc2235fd6262605f2026
spent
true